More on San Pancho
Located in Nayarit, Mexico, San Pancho is a fun left point break that offers up speedy, rippable and at times barreling sections. The waves here are straightforward to surf and break for up to 100 meters over a rock and sand bottom.
What are the best surf conditions for San Pancho?
Gets good between waist-high and double overhead. We recommend riding a longboard if smaller and a shortboard then step up as the size picks up. This break is suitable for intermediate and advanced-level surfers. The surf here is consistent (7/10) and will get crowded (8/10). The best winds are from the East. The best swells are from the South, Southwest, and West. Works on a low to mid-tide best.
